Programmable Electronic Interconnect System And Method Of Making

US Patent:
4779340, Oct 25, 1988
Filed:
Nov 24, 1986
Appl. No.:
6/934619
Inventors:
Douglas P. Kihm - Salt Lake City UT
John R. deJong - Salt Lake City UT
Assignee:
Axonix Corporation - Salt Lake City UT
International Classification:
H05K 302, H05K 100
US Classification:
29847
Abstract:
A carrier board has electronic circuit components mounted thereon which are conductively connected to carrier board connectors which are in turn interconnected to an interconnect board. The interconnect board has a plurality of first conductors and second conductors that are separated and positioned to intersect to form a plurality of intersections. The first and second conductors may be selectively placed into conductive contact at selected intersect points to thereby form a desired electronic circuit. The interconnect board specifically includes a deformable material between the first and second conductors which are conductively connectable alternately and selectively through the imposition of pressure and temperature.
